A local-first React app for OpenRouter: pick free and custom models, stream replies, and compare 2–4 models side by side with latency and token metrics. Your OpenRouter API key stays in the browser (localStorage); the UI never sends it to this project’s servers—there is no backend account system in the app.

| Capability | Description |
|---|---|
| OpenRouter chat | Uses https://openrouter.ai/api/v1/chat/completions with streaming. |
| Model directory | Loads models from OpenRouter’s API (public /models endpoint → works without an API key on first visit). Highlights free-tier models (:free / $0-style pricing). Curated fallback list when offline. |
| Custom model IDs | Add any OpenRouter model id (including paid) in Settings. |
| Tiled comparison | One user message → parallel requests to multiple models → grid of answers with per-model TTFT, total ms, tokens (when the API returns usage). |
| Chats | Multiple conversations, titles from the first user message, persist locally. |
| Specs | Specs button next to the model opens pricing, context, modalities, and link to OpenRouter. |
| Attachments | Images, audio, and video (first-frame preview) → multimodal messages for OpenRouter. |
| Charts | Assistant can output fenced ```openbentt-chart JSON → Recharts bar/line/area in the thread. Legacy ```cogerphere-chart fences are still parsed. |
| Workspaces | Notebook (LaTeX/PDF), Research labs, LaTeX preview, Benchmark, WebGPU — route-aware system prompts. |
| Retry / Edit | Retry on the last assistant reply; Edit (pencil on user bubble) reloads the composer. |
| Thread tools (Home) | Search (with in-message highlights), Export .md, Shortcuts; composer Snippets (saved prompts, local only). |
| Theme | Light default; dark mode in Settings. |
| Analytics | Vercel Analytics (if deployed on Vercel). |
The product name is Openbentt. Older localStorage keys and chart fences may still use the legacy cogerphere-* prefix; the app migrates storage on first load.

Note: Chat and OpenRouter calls are from the user’s browser. Optional features that need a small server (research proxy, remote LaTeX compile) are not included in a plain static upload unless you add those endpoints and set the matching VITE_* values or in-app URLs.
Includes nginx on :8080 and the research proxy (Brave search optional).
DOCKER_BUILDKIT=1 docker compose up --build
# or: npm run docker:build && docker run --rm -p 8080:8080 openbenttWhy the first build feels slow: the image runs npm ci and, unless BusyTeX is already present, downloads ~175MB of WASM assets (texlyre-busytex). Expect several minutes the first time; later builds reuse Docker layer cache. To skip the download on your machine, run once in the repo root: npm run download:busytex (creates public/core/busytex/), then build again — the Dockerfile detects busytex.wasm and skips fetching.
For everyday UI work, npm run dev is much faster than rebuilding the image.

| Variable | When to set | Purpose |
|---|---|---|
VITE_PUBLIC_SITE_URL |
Build (CI / npm run build) |
Canonical URL, Open Graph / Twitter absolute image URLs. No trailing slash. |
VITE_RESEARCH_PROXY_URL |
Build (optional) | Base URL for the research HTTP proxy; Docker defaults to same-origin /api. |
VITE_LATEX_COMPILE_URL |
Build (optional) | Remote POST /compile endpoint for full-document LaTeX PDF (see server/latex-compile.mjs). |
VITE_LATEX_REMOTE |
Build (optional) | Set to 1 to prefer HTTP compile over in-browser WASM. |
BRAVE_SEARCH_API_KEY |
Runtime (Docker / proxy host only) | Not a VITE_ var; enables Brave search inside server/research-proxy.mjs. |
Authoritative commented template: .env.example.
